10 Common Mistakes to Avoid When Building Your Website

Building a website for your business can be a game-changer. But without proper planning and execution, you can end up with a site that drives visitors away rather than attracting them. Here are 10 common mistakes to avoid when building your website:

1. Not Defining a Clear Purpose

Before you even start designing or working with a designer, ask yourself: What is the purpose of this website? Is it to generate leads, sell products, or simply provide information? Without a clear goal, your website will lack direction, and visitors won’t know what action to take. Every page should guide visitors toward that goal, whether it’s filling out a contact form or purchasing a product.

2. Overloading with Too Much Information

It’s tempting to cram your website with all the details about your business. But too much text, images, and media can overwhelm visitors. Focus on the essentials. Use clear, concise language to convey your message and break up large blocks of text with headings, bullet points, and visuals to make the content more digestible.

3. Ignoring Mobile Optimization

With more than half of web traffic coming from mobile devices, having a mobile-friendly website is non-negotiable. Many businesses make the mistake of only optimizing for the desktop, leaving mobile users frustrated. Choose a responsive design that adjusts to different screen sizes, ensuring a seamless experience on smartphones and tablets.

4. Complicated Navigation

If users can’t find what they’re looking for quickly, they’ll leave. Don’t clutter your site with too many menu items or complex navigation structures. Keep it simple and intuitive. A clear, easy-to-use navigation bar with a few well-organized categories will help visitors find what they need without frustration.

5. Poor Call-to-Action Placement

A strong website guides visitors to take specific actions, whether it’s signing up for a newsletter, contacting you, or making a purchase. However, many websites fail to place their CTAs in noticeable or compelling locations. Avoid vague language like “Submit” or “Click Here.” Instead, use direct, action-oriented CTAs like “Get a Free Quote” or “Shop Now,” and place them prominently on key pages.

6. Slow Load Times

A slow website frustrates users and can cause them to abandon your site altogether. Google also penalizes slow websites, affecting your SEO ranking. Ensure your site loads quickly by optimizing images, using a reliable hosting service, and minimizing the use of large files and plugins. Tools like Google PageSpeed Insights can help identify areas for improvement.

7. Neglecting SEO

No matter how great your website looks, if people can’t find it, it won’t serve its purpose. SEO is key to increasing your site’s visibility on search engines like Google. Many new website owners make the mistake of ignoring SEO basics, such as optimizing page titles, meta descriptions, alt text for images, and using relevant keywords throughout the content.

8. Using Poor-Quality Images

Images are essential for creating an engaging website, but using low-resolution or stock photos that don’t fit your brand can harm your credibility. Invest in high-quality images that are relevant to your business and visually appealing. If you’re showcasing your products or portfolio, consider professional photography to present your work in the best light.

9. Not Updating Content Regularly

Your website should not be a “set it and forget it” project. Fresh content keeps your site relevant and improves your SEO rankings. Regularly updating your blog, refreshing product information, and sharing new case studies or testimonials will keep your audience engaged and your website performing well.

10. Forgetting to Include Analytics

Building a website is just the first step—understanding how it performs is equally important. Many business owners forget to set up analytics tools like Google Analytics to track visitor behavior, traffic sources, and conversion rates. Without this data, you’re essentially flying blind, unable to see what’s working and what needs improvement.
